Output 0966581796baa79fd41b267879e208dbabe20c6f13698597526b253b35ab6794:17

value
8649549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a65ff92c61e60267513eb7df7f2bff7d4c72fa77 OP_EQUAL
address
3Grj4jPkRru4QY1CDL9jV3EYEKp8sEZYkH
transaction
0966581796baa79fd41b267879e208dbabe20c6f13698597526b253b35ab6794
spent
true